A man in his 50s has been stabbed to death at a large house party in an affluent northern Brisbane suburb, with a 15-year-old in custody and charged with murder

Police swooped on a home at Oriel Road in Clayfield at about 8.15pm on Thursday, after they were called about a man sustaining critical injuries.

A 58-year-old man was found unresponsive upstairs in the large three-storey home where there were roughly 30 young people.

A crime scene was established and the group of teenagers have assisted police with their inquiries. 

Acting Assistant Commissioner Rhys Wildman said an altercation took place between the 15-year-old and the 58-year-old man who are believed to be known to each other.

It is alleged a household implement was used. 

‘There was some sort of altercation that’s resulted in this 58-year-old male tragically, losing his life,’ he said.

‘It’s not a case of carrying knives, it’s unfortunately allotted in a home.’

Police found the 15-year-old boy near the home and took him into custody.

Following investigations, detectives have since charged the teenager with one count of murder domestic violence offence. 

He was refused police bail and is due to appear in Brisbane Childrens Court on Friday.

The scene that officers arrived to has been described by Inspector Jane Healy as ‘confronting’, she told Channel 7’s Sunrise.

‘It was quite a confusing and confronting scene when police arrived,’ she said.

‘We are still establishing a timeline of what has happened.’

Police have appealing to anyone who may have information that could assist, or who may have CCTV or dashcam footage from the area, to come forward.
